GREAT NECK POINT and the Virginia Beach real estate market
South Woodside Lane sits in the northern reaches of Virginia Beach, tucked into a quiet residential pocket near the Lynnhaven waterway corridor. The surrounding streets have a settled, established feel — mature trees, generous lot sizes, and neighbors who tend to stay a while. It's a part of Virginia Beach that doesn't get as much attention as the Oceanfront or Town Center, but locals know it well: convenient to everything, calm enough to actually enjoy. Virginia Beach as a whole is one of the largest cities by land area on the East Coast, and this location puts you squarely in the sweet spot — close to the water, close to two major military installations, and close to the everyday amenities that make life genuinely comfortable. The broader Lynnhaven area carries a laid-back coastal character without the tourist-season traffic that comes with living closer to the beach resort strip.
